Jamie Lee Curtis’ door color could raise your house value
The article discusses the impact of a black front door on a home's curb appeal and perceived value, citing Jamie Lee Curtis's Los Angeles home as a prime example. The actress's entrance, featuring a classic black front door complemented by maidenhair fern and ivy, is presented as a sophisticated and nostalgic blueprint for homeowners seeking to enhance their property's exterior without extensive renovations. The black front door is highlighted as a simple yet effective design choice that radiates sophistication and contributes positively to a home's market value.
Design experts and real estate agents endorse the black front door trend, noting its inspiring qualities. Jamie Lee Curtis's approach involves pairing the black door with complementary outdoor lighting and landscaping with maidenhair ferns, ensuring the entrance appears inviting rather than stark or harsh. This thoughtful combination is crucial for achieving a balanced and elegant first impression.
A Zillow color study is referenced, which measured offer prices nationwide and found that homes with black front doors typically received bids approximately $6,450 higher than comparable homes with differently colored doors. Buyers in the study described the look as sophisticated and secure, two perceptions that directly translate into a higher perceived value for the property. This data supports the notion that a black front door is not merely an aesthetic choice but a financially beneficial one.
The article further illustrates the tangible benefits of a black front door with a real-world example from Miami. A property listing saw a surge in second showings and eventually sold 4% above the neighborhood average after its weathered beige door was repainted a deep satin black for under $100. This anecdote underscores the significant return on investment that a simple color change can yield. The visual impact of black is also explained; it helps the eye perceive the entry as a strong, singular shape, contributing to a balanced facade and guiding visitors toward the threshold, which signals order and care within the home.
Estate agents consider painting a front door black a rare upgrade that simultaneously improves both first impressions and appraised value. They frequently include it alongside essential pre-sale activities like lawn maintenance and clean windows on their checklists. The article concludes by emphasizing that this classic decorating quirk, exemplified by Jamie Lee Curtis, is universally appealing and effective, regardless of geographical location.
